Highlights

On average, there are 204 sunny days per year in Princeton. Eugene averages 155 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Princeton, New Jersey gets 47.4 inches of rain, on average, per year. Eugene, Oregon gets 47 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.

Princeton averages 24 inches of snow per year. Eugene averages 3 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

August is the hottest month for Eugene with an average high temperature of 82.4°, which ranks it as about average compared to other places in Oregon. In Eugene,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Eugene are September, July and August.

July is the hottest month for Princeton with an average high temperature of 85.6°, which ranks it as warmer than most places in New Jersey. In Princeton,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Princeton are September, June and August.
December has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Eugene with an average of 33.9°. This is warmer than most places in Oregon.

January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Princeton with an average of 22.0°. This is colder than most places in New Jersey.

In Eugene, there are 13.1 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is cooler than most places in Oregon.

In Princeton, there are 16.8 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is about average compared to other places in New Jersey.

In Eugene, there are 46.9 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is about average compared to other places in Oregon.

In Princeton, there are 109.7 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is colder than most places in New Jersey.

In Eugene, there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is about average compared to other places in Oregon.

In Princeton, there are 0.3 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is warmer than most places in New Jersey.

December is the wettest month in Eugene with 7.8 inches of rain, and the driest month is July with 0.6 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 42% of yearly precipitation and 6%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 47.0 inches in Eugene means that it is wetter than most places in Oregon.


July is the wettest month in Princeton with 5.1 inches of rain, and the driest month is February with 2.5 inches. The wettest season is Autumn with 29% of yearly precipitation and 20% occurs in Spring,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 47.4 inches in Princeton means that it is about average compared to other places in New Jersey.

December is the rainiest month in Eugene with 18.9 days of rain, and July is the driest month with only 3.2 rainy days. There are 151.2 rainy days annually in Eugene, which is rainier than most places in Oregon.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 35%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 10% chance of a rainy day.

May is the rainiest month in Princeton with 12.4 days of rain, and September is the driest month with only 8.7 rainy days. There are 124.6 rainy days annually in Princeton, which is one of the rainiest places in New Jersey. The rainiest season is Summer when it rains 28% of the time and the driest is Winter with only a 22% chance of a rainy day.

An annual snowfall of 3.0 inches in Eugene means that it is about average compared to other places in Oregon.

An annual snowfall of 24.0 inches in Princeton means that it is about average compared to other places in New Jersey.
February is the snowiest month in Eugene with 1.4 inches of snow, and 3 months of the year have significant snowfall.

February is the snowiest month in Princeton with 8.3 inches of snow, and 5 months of the year have significant snowfall.

DID YOU KNOW?

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.

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.

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
